I have an old Professional Sound Corporation MX-4S mixer. I am
searching for a 2-channel add-on component that connects via the
multi-pin port on the left side of the mixer. Basically, it makes your
4-channel mixer a 6-channel mixer! According to Professional Sound
Corporation, only a few of these add-on devices were made for the
MX-4S, which went out of production about 14 years ago.

if its line level unbalance parallel input , you can stick there every
mixer or preamp and feed the main bus
I don't familiar with that one but usually its -10 dbv level inputs
